SCOOTER CARE AND STORAGE
7 8 8
Do not use any harsh chemical
products on plastic parts. Be
sure to avoid using cloths or
sponges which have been in
contact with strong or abra-
sive cleaning products, sol-
vent or thinner, fuel (gasoline),
rust removers or inhibitors,
brake fluid, antifreeze or elec-
trolyte.
8 8
Do not use high-pressure
washers or steam-jet cleaners
since they cause water seep-
age and deterioration in the
following areas: seals (of
wheel and swingarm bearings,
fork and brakes), electric com-
ponents (couplers, connec-
tors, instruments, switches
and lights), breather hoses
and vents.8 8
For scooters equipped with a
windshield: Do not use strong
cleaners or hard sponges as
they will cause dulling or
scratching. Some cleaning
compounds for plastic may
leave scratches on the wind-
shield. Test the product on a
small hidden part of the wind-
shield to make sure that it
does not leave any marks. If
the windshield is scratched,
use a quality plastic polishing
compound after washing.After normal use
Remove dirt with warm water, a mild
detergent, and a soft, clean sponge,
and then rinse thoroughly with clean
water. Use a toothbrush or bottle-
brush for hard-to-reach areas.
Stubborn dirt and insects will come
off more easily if the area is covered
with a wet cloth for a few minutes
before cleaning.After riding in the rain, near the sea
or on salt-sprayed roads
Since sea salt or salt sprayed on the
roads during winter are extremely
corrosive in combination with water,
carry out the following steps after
each ride in the rain, near the sea or
on salt-sprayed roads.
NOTE:
Salt sprayed on roads in the winter
may remain well into spring.
1. Clean the scooter with cold water
and a mild detergent after the
engine has cooled down.
ECA00012
cC
Do not use warm water since it
increases the corrosive action of
the salt.
2. Apply a corrosion protection
spray on all metal, including
chrome- and nickel-plated, sur-
faces to prevent corrosion.

SCOOTER CARE AND STORAGE
75. Lubricate all control cables and
the pivoting points of all levers
and pedals as well as of the
sidestand/centerstand.
6. Check and, if necessary, correct
the tire air pressure, and then lift
the scooter so that both of its
wheels are off the ground.
Alternatively, turn the wheels a
little every month in order to pre-
vent the tires from becoming
degraded in one spot.
7. Cover the muffler outlet with a
plastic bag to prevent moisture
from entering it.8. Remove the battery and fully
charge it. Store it in a cool, dry
place and charge it once a
month. Do not store the battery
in an excessively cold or warm
place [less than 0 °C or more
than 30 °C]. For more informa-
tion on storing the battery, see
page 6-35.
NOTE:
Make any necessary repairs before
storing the scooter.

SPECIFICATIONS
8
SpecificationsSpecificationsModel YP250A
Dimensions
Overall length 2,145 mm
Overall width 770 mm
Overall height 1,350 mm
Seat height 730 mm
Wheelbase 1,535 mm
Ground clearance 120 mm
Minimum turning radius 2,700 mm
Basic weight (with oil and full
fuel tank)177 kg
Engine
Engine type Liquid-cooled 4-stroke, SOHC
Cylinder arrangement Forward inclined single
cylinder
Displacement 249 cm
3
Bore ×Stroke 69.0 ×66.8 mm
Compression ratio 10:1
Starting system Electric starter
Lubrication system Wet sumpEngine oil
Type
Recommended engine oil
classification API Service SE, SF, SG type
or higher
cC
Do not use oils with a diesel specification of “CD” or oils of a
higher quality than specified. In addition, do not use oils
labeled “ENERGY CONSERVING II” or higher.
Quantity
Periodic oil change 1.2 L
Total amount (dry engine) 1.4 L
